Micropiles are significant capacity, small diameter (5” to 12”) drilled and grouted in-area piles designed with metal reinforcement to mainly resist structural loading. Micropiles have swiftly acquired level of popularity for foundations in urbanized areas or in locations with lower headroom and restricted accessibility.

Micropiles will also be utilized for retaining wall earth retention, which can be essential in areas that would be prone to landslides. The micropiles are handy for underpinning structures that already exist, and reinforcement for slope stabilization.

They are generally utilised to replace deteriorating foundation devices, to the renovation of structures, to support constructions affected by adjacent construction, for seismic retrofitting or in-situ reinforcement like High-strength micro piles embankment, slope and landslide stabilization.
